Vulnerability from bitnami_vulndb
A security issue in MongoDB Server allows an authenticated user with elevated internal privileges to bypass a disabled feature gate in the applyOps command by specifying an internal replication mode value that was not intended to be client-selectable. This bypass enables execution of container operations that are disabled by default in production configurations, allowing direct storage-engine writes to arbitrary internal storage tables. The authorization check for these operations validates only the operation's namespace, not the actual storage target, enabling writes to unrelated internal metadata or other collections' data.
